John Kelly Hall of Fame

John Kelly

  • Class
    1990
  • Induction
    2004
  • Sport(s)
    Baseball
John Kelly (1987-90) is simply the greatest four-year pitcher in the history of Kennesaw State baseball. He was a 1990 Honorable Mention All-American and still holds a remarkable, 10, KSU pitching records. Over his stellar four-year career, Kelly is the Owls all-time leader in wins (47), strikeouts (318), complete games (51), shutouts (14), innings pitched (536.1) and appearances (84). In 1990 he established the still-standing school record for wins with 16.
